117.info
人生若只如初见

linux漏洞扫描怎么进行

Linux漏洞扫描可以通过以下几个步骤进行:

  1. 收集系统信息:首先需要收集目标系统的基本信息,包括操作系统版本、内核版本、已安装的软件包等。可以使用命令如uname -acat /etc/issuelsb_release -a等来获取系统信息。

  2. 确定漏洞数据库:选择合适的漏洞数据库,如CVE(Common Vulnerabilities and Exposures)数据库、NVD(National Vulnerability Database)等,以获取最新的漏洞信息。

  3. 扫描漏洞:使用漏洞扫描工具对目标系统进行扫描,发现潜在的漏洞。常用的漏洞扫描工具包括OpenVAS、Nessus、Nexpose等。

  4. 分析扫描结果:根据漏洞扫描工具的输出结果,分析潜在漏洞的危害程度和可能的攻击路径。对于高危漏洞,应该尽快采取修复措施。

  5. 打补丁和更新:根据漏洞扫描结果,及时应用操作系统和软件的安全补丁,以修复已知漏洞。同时,确保系统中安装的软件包都是最新版本,以避免已知漏洞。

  6. 配置安全设置:对操作系统和应用程序进行安全配置,关闭不必要的服务和端口,采用强密码和加密方式进行身份验证,限制用户权限等,以增加系统的安全性。

  7. 定期扫描漏洞:漏洞扫描不是一次性的工作,应该定期进行扫描,以发现和修复新的漏洞。

需要注意的是,漏洞扫描只是一种发现潜在漏洞的方法,不能保证系统的绝对安全。在进行漏洞扫描之前,应该获得合法的授权,并遵守相关法律法规。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e316AzsLBg9XBlM.html

推荐文章

  • 如何用Linux strings提取日志中的关键信息

    strings 是一个 Linux 命令行工具,用于从二进制文件、内存转储或其他非文本文件中提取可打印的字符串。要从日志文件中提取关键信息,你可以使用 strings 命令结...

  • SecureCRT在Linux中如何进行文件压缩与解压

    在Linux系统中,通常使用命令行工具来进行文件的压缩与解压。虽然SecureCRT是一个强大的终端仿真程序,但它本身并不直接提供文件压缩和解压的功能。不过,你可以...

  • 如何优化Linux nohup日志记录

    优化Linux nohup日志记录可以通过以下几种方法来实现: 日志分割: 使用logrotate工具来分割日志文件,防止日志文件过大。logrotate可以定期分割日志文件,并压缩...

  • Linux MinIO性能如何提升

    Linux MinIO的性能提升可以从多个方面入手,以下是一些关键的策略和建议:
    硬件优化 增加硬盘数量和容量:使用更多的硬盘可以显著提高IOPS(每秒输入/输出操...

  • python怎么把list转成string

    可以使用join方法将列表转换为字符串。join方法接受一个可迭代对象作为参数,并将其中的元素连接为一个字符串。可以使用空字符串作为连接符。
    以下是一个示...

  • python中如何拼接字符串

    在Python中,可以使用"+"运算符或者使用字符串的join()方法来拼接字符串。下面是两种方法的示例: 使用"+"运算符拼接字符串: str1 = "Hello"
    str2 = "Worl...

  • java堆空间错误如何解决

    Java堆空间错误通常是由于内存不足导致的,可以通过以下几种方式来解决: 增加堆空间大小:通过设置JVM启动参数-Xmx和-Xms调整堆空间的大小,例如:-Xmx4g表示最...

  • Java中page如何遍历

    在Java中,可以使用循环来遍历页码。以下是一个示例代码:
    int totalPages = 10; // 总页数
    int currentPage = 1; // 当前页码
    for (int i = 1; ...